Ricky Moezinia

Details

Ricky Moezinia is currently building Ritual, an AI infrastructure company. Previously, he built Alta, a fintech company, worked as a software engineer on Novi and Diem (ex Libra) at Facebook, and as a quant at Point72. He advises and invests in startups through Leo Capital.
